Iris 'Gypsy Romance'
Iris germanica
'Gypsy Romance'
The Iris 'Gypsy Romance' (Iris germanica 'Gypsy Romance') is a perennial plant with attractive purple flowers. The following is information regarding the growth characteristics, propagation methods, cultivation methods, garden uses, and important pests and diseases and control methods for this iris. Growth Characteristics - Sunlight: Irises prefer ample sunlight but can also thrive in partial shade. - Soil: They prefer well-drained soil. Soil with a pH of slightly acidic to neutral is ideal. - Water: They tolerate relatively dry conditions well, but require adequate moisture during the growing season. - Temperature: They grow well in cool climates and possess strong cold tolerance. Propagation Methods - Root Division: This is the most common method of propagation; roots are divided and planted in the summer or early autumn. - Seeds: Propagation by seeds is possible, but it is generally not preferred as it is time-consuming. Cultivation Methods - Planting: Plant via root division in late summer or early autumn. 2. Spacing: Plants should be spaced approximately 30–40 cm apart. - Fertilizer: It is recommended to use a slow-release fertilizer during the early stages of growth. - Winter Preparation: In cool regions, protect the plants with mulch during the winter. Uses in the Garden Due to its beautiful flowers, the Iris 'Gypsy Romance' is well-suited for garden borders or flowerbeds. Plant Family
Iris family
Height
90~120cm
Spread
30~60cm
Colors
purple
Bloom Period
May~June
Water Needs
commonly
Exposure
Sunny
Freezing Resistance
-5°C
